Evidence-based medical ethics
From WikiMD's Food, Medicine & Wellness Encyclopedia
A form of medical ethics that uses knowledge from ethical principles, legal precedent, and evidence-based medicine to draw solutions to ethical dilemmas in the health care field. Sometimes this is also referred to as argument-based medical ethics.
